Bank of Tanzania Publishes Healthy Monthly Economic Review

Bank of Tanzania published on 14th August 2013 its latest Monthly Economic Review published covering July 2013.

The reports covers inflation and food supply, monetary and financial markets developments, government budgetary operations, external sector performances, national debts development and economic development in Zanzibar.

Once again during the month covered the annual headline inflation decelerated to 7.6 % from 8.3% in May.

Interbank Money Market Weighted Average Rate (WAR) also saw a four months law with 4.98 on 12th August 2013.
